Although there is a considerable body of written literature available on how to implement innovation in businesses and organizations, and, at the same time, many technological innovations are being applied within the field of teaching and learning, we do not find many references to innovative experiences implemented on a large scale within a university and generalized to its faculty and students. Normally, technological innovations are intensively used by a small proportion of the faculty and it is very difficult to generalize them to the rest of the teaching staff. As a result, the benefit that would be gained from their implementation for the other students is lost.
